Written Answers. - Mortgage Relief Costs.

Noel Ahern

Question:

47 Mr. N. Ahern asked the Minister for Finance if he will give details of the cost of mortgage relief allowed to taxpayers for each of the last five years; and an estimate for 1993.

Following is the information requested in so far as it is available.

Interest Relief

Year

Estimated Cost to the Exchequer

£m

1988-89

134.9

1989-90

142.8

1990-91

159.0*

1991-92

176.3*

1992-93

188.0*

* Provisional.
The latest estimate available of the cost of interest relief for the 1993-94 tax year, based on the interest rates prevailing at budget time, is £253m. This estimate allows for the cost of the budget measures regarding the relief.
The figures include a relatively small element of loan interest other than mortgage interest.
